WebJul 24, 2015 · The berm sits on the downhill side of the swale and is the perfect place to grow trees and deep rooting plants like strawberries, rhubarb, asparagus, comfrey, and dandelions. The deep roots will keep the berm stable, as well as suck up the moisture from below so that the newly hydrated soil doesn’t become overly saturated. An underground reservoir in a swale system. WebApr 10, 2024 · Of Salt and Soil. Salt and agricultural crops don’t mix well. Most seeds don’t germinate well in salty conditions (soybeans are more sensitive than crops like cotton), and salt water damages soil structure. Matt Ricker and his lab at North Carolina State University monitor and document salt levels in soils in Hyde County.
